<h3>What is considered an ethnic enclave?</h3>
In sociology, an ethnic enclave is a geographic place with high ethnic concentration, characteristic cultural identity, and financial activity. The time period is usually used to refer to both a residential location or a workspace with a high awareness of ethnic firms.
